Rumah  >  Artikel  >  pangkalan data  >  Apakah jenis data yang digunakan dalam kelas dalam mysql?

Apakah jenis data yang digunakan dalam kelas dalam mysql?

下次还敢
下次还敢asal
2024-05-09 08:51:19905semak imbas

Jenis data terbaik untuk menyimpan maklumat kelas dalam MySQL: VARCHAR: rentetan panjang berubah-ubah, sesuai untuk menyimpan nama kelas, penerangan dan maklumat lain. INT: Integer, sesuai untuk menyimpan maklumat berangka seperti nombor kelas, gred, dsb. CHAR: rentetan panjang tetap, sesuai untuk menyimpan maklumat rentetan panjang tetap seperti kod kelas. ENUM: Jenis penghitungan, yang hanya boleh menyimpan pilihan terhad yang dipratentukan, seperti jenis kelas. SET: Jenis set, yang boleh menyimpan berbilang nilai yang dipratentukan untuk maklumat seperti kursus atau aktiviti pilihan kelas.

Apakah jenis data yang digunakan dalam kelas dalam mysql?

Jenis data terbaik untuk menyimpan maklumat kelas dalam MySQL

Apabila menyimpan maklumat kelas dalam pangkalan data MySQL, jenis data berikut boleh digunakan mengikut keperluan khusus:

  • Penerangan: Rentetan panjang boleh ubah, panjang sehingga 65,535 aksara.
Kelebihan:

Sesuai untuk menyimpan nama kelas, penerangan dan maklumat lain, membenarkan penggunaan panjang berubah-ubah, jadi ia boleh menyesuaikan diri dengan maklumat kelas dengan panjang yang berbeza.

    INT
  • Penerangan: Integer antara -2,147,483,648 hingga 2,147,483,647.
Kelebihan:

Sesuai untuk menyimpan maklumat berangka seperti nombor kelas, gred, dan lain-lain. Ia mengambil lebih sedikit ruang dan mempunyai kecekapan pertanyaan yang tinggi.

    CHAR
  • Penerangan: Rentetan panjang tetap, panjang ditetapkan pada nilai yang ditentukan.
Kelebihan:

Sesuai untuk menyimpan maklumat rentetan yang memerlukan panjang tetap seperti kod kelas Ia mengambil sedikit ruang daripada VARCHAR, tetapi tidak cukup fleksibel.

    ENUM
  • Penerangan: Jenis penghitungan yang hanya boleh menyimpan set nilai pratakrif tertentu.
Kelebihan:

Sesuai untuk menyimpan jenis kelas dengan hanya bilangan pilihan yang terhad, seperti "kelas biasa", "kelas eksperimen", dll. untuk memastikan integriti dan konsistensi data.

    SET
  • Penerangan: Jenis koleksi yang boleh menyimpan berbilang nilai pratakrif yang dipisahkan dengan koma.
Kelebihan:

Sesuai untuk menyimpan maklumat seperti kursus pilihan atau aktiviti untuk kelas, membolehkan kelas tergolong dalam beberapa kategori pada masa yang sama.

  • Apabila memilih jenis data tertentu, anda perlu mengambil kira faktor berikut:
  • Panjang dan kerumitan maklumat kelas
  • Sama ada panjang tetap atau panjang berubah diperlukan
  • Sama ada jenis kelas perlu terhad

Sama ada ia perlu menyokong berbilang nilai Pilih

🎜🎜Berdasarkan faktor ini, pilihan yang paling sesuai boleh dibuat untuk menyimpan dan mengurus maklumat kelas dengan cekap. 🎜

Atas ialah kandungan terperinci Apakah jenis data yang digunakan dalam kelas dalam mysql?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n